About Retirement Law in Seville, Spain
Retirement in Seville, Spain is governed by a set of laws and regulations that outline the rights and benefits available to retirees. These laws are designed to ensure that individuals can retire with financial security and maintain a certain standard of living during their retirement years.
Why You May Need a Lawyer
There are several situations where you may require legal assistance in relation to retirement in Seville, Spain. This could include disputes over pension benefits, issues with retirement savings accounts, or navigating the complexities of tax laws related to retirement income. A lawyer can provide valuable guidance and advocacy to help you protect your rights and secure the retirement benefits you are entitled to.
Local Laws Overview
Key aspects of local laws in Seville that are particularly relevant to retirement include the eligibility criteria for state pension benefits, regulations governing private pension plans, and tax laws that may impact retirement income. It is important to understand these laws to ensure that you are maximizing your retirement benefits and complying with legal requirements.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. Can I receive a state pension in Seville, Spain?
Yes, individuals who have contributed to the Spanish social security system are eligible for a state pension in Seville, Spain.
2. Are there age requirements for retirement in Seville?
Yes, the retirement age in Spain is currently set at 65, although there are provisions for early or deferred retirement.
3. How can I calculate my pension benefits?
Pension benefits in Spain are calculated based on the number of years you have contributed to the social security system and your average earnings during that time.
4. Can I access my pension savings early?
In some cases, individuals may be able to access their pension savings early due to financial hardship or other qualifying circumstances.
5. What are the tax implications of retirement income in Seville?
Retirement income in Seville may be subject to income tax, depending on the source of the income and your overall tax situation.
6. Can I work while receiving a pension in Seville?
It is possible to work while receiving a pension in Seville, although there are restrictions on the amount of income you can earn before it affects your pension benefits.
7. What are my options for private pension plans in Seville?
Individuals in Seville have the option to contribute to private pension plans, which can provide additional retirement income beyond the state pension.
8. What happens to my pension benefits if I move to another country?
If you move to another country, you may still be able to receive your Spanish pension benefits, depending on the specific agreement between Spain and the country you are moving to.
